ABOUT POET BIOPROCESSINGOur 28 Bioprocessing facilities produce over 1.9 billion gallons of ethanol, 5 million tons of Dakota Gold distillers grain animal feed and 600 million pounds of our Voila® corn oil. That’s a lot of product! In addition, we provide CO2 to the beverage industry and contribute to sustainable roadways. We also buy 650 million bushels of corn per year from local producers. It is our role at POET bioprocessing to ensure safe, efficient, and profitable operations at each facility.JOB SUMMARYThe Plant Technician I is responsible for the operation of all plant processing equipment and performing routine basic maintenance in a highly automated chemical facility. In the area of maintenance, Plant Technicians are responsible for the safe and efficient maintenance, basic repair, and cleaning of all equipment associated with bioprocessing processes. At times, Plant Technicians may be asked to assist Maintenance Technicians in more technical and complex maintenance procedures. Team members in this position are required to maintain knowledge of the process flow, computerized equipment, and be aware of hazards associated with the process as well as understand and execute standard operating procedures (SOPs). Continuous plant operation requires 12-hour shift work. Plant Technicians must be able to adapt to 12-hour workdays and be able to meet call-in requirements as needed.DURING A TYPICAL DAY (IF THERE IS ONE), YOU WILL:

Use your knowledge to maintain and operate all processes associated with the plant where required.

Perform maintenance and basic repairs of plant equipment and document these activities.

Operate the DCS (Distributed Control System) for the plant.

Safely perform basic electrical troubleshooting.

Follow procedures for plant start-up, shut-down, cleaning, and batching.

Maintain accurate and timely logs.

Collect and test quality control samples, interpret QA/QC results and make adjustments to optimize plant operations, timely and accurately document results and enter results into our data collection system, PI.

Assist in removal, installation, rebuild, and performance of preventive and predictive maintenance on all equipment associated with plant processes.

Help to keep your plant clean by following the sanitation schedule and completing all tasks as assigned.

Notify the management team of safety, environmental, quality and production concerns, problems and opportunities.

Keep your plant safe by fostering a culture of safe behavior and environmental compliance.

Maintain a team environment at all times and champion POET in the community.
